Choosing the Right Nissan Titan Iridium Spark Plug: Key Factors to Consider
Electrode Material and Construction
Electrode composition determines longevity and spark consistency. Iridium tips are harder and wear more slowly than conventional copper, preserving a fine gap for longer service intervals. For the Titan, a fine-wire iridium center electrode typically offers a more concentrated spark energy, which helps combustion stability during cold starts and under load.
Construction details such as the presence of a platinum ground electrode, welded vs attached center electrodes, and overall tip geometry also influence how the spark forms and how resistant the plug is to erosion. Durable construction reduces the frequency of replacements and helps maintain consistent ignition timing across the recommended service interval.
Thread Size, Reach, and Fitment
Correct thread size and reach prevent mechanical damage to the cylinder head and ensure the electrode sits in the proper combustion zone. Using a plug with the wrong reach can upset combustion characteristics or cause contact with the piston in extreme cases. For the Nissan Titan, confirming OEM-equivalent thread dimensions and hex size simplifies installation and reduces the risk of cross-threading or breakage.
Fitment also covers seat type and gasket presence. Some engines require a specific seat style to maintain proper sealing and heat transfer. Ensuring these mechanical dimensions match OEM specifications preserves engine performance and avoids leaks or misfires caused by improper seating.
Heat Range and Thermal Management
Heat range affects how quickly a plug clears deposits and handles combustion chamber temperatures. A plug that is too hot can cause pre-ignition, while one that is too cold can foul with carbon or oil deposits. Choosing a heat range suited to the Titan's typical operating conditions balances deposit control with resistance to overheating when towing or driving aggressively.
Consider expected use: frequent short trips and city driving favor a slightly hotter plug to resist fouling, whereas lots of sustained highway speed or heavy towing may require a cooler plug to avoid overheating. Manufacturers publish heat range numbers differently, so focus on matching the function rather than the absolute value when selecting replacement plugs.
Recommended Spark Plug Gap and Gap Stability
The correct spark plug gap ensures the spark reliably crosses the electrodes under the Titan's ignition voltage and compression conditions. An optimal gap promotes efficient combustion, better fuel economy, and reduced misfires. Iridium plugs often ship pre-gapped, but confirming the gap and adjusting if necessary is a good practice before installation.
Gap stability matters because erosion widens the gap over time, requiring larger ignition voltage and increasing the risk of misfires. Iridium's wear resistance helps maintain gap tolerance longer than softer metals. When changing plugs, use the vehicle's specified gap and torque to preserve electrode alignment and performance.
Resistance to Fouling and Combustion Deposits
Plugs that resist fouling hold up better under the variety of fuels and driving patterns a Titan owner might encounter. Fouling can cause rough idle, reduced power, and difficulty starting. Iridium plugs with fine tips and certain ground electrode shapes tend to shed deposits more effectively and sustain stable combustion over miles of mixed driving.
Consider engine condition and oil consumption. Higher oil burn or rich-running conditions accelerate deposit formation, so selecting plugs known for fouling resistance helps extend service intervals and maintain consistent engine response.

When to Replace Spark Plugs on a Nissan Titan
Typical maintenance intervals vary by plug type and driving conditions. Iridium plugs often last substantially longer than conventional plugs, but symptoms and routine checks should guide replacement timing for your Titan.
Watch for common indicators such as decreased fuel economy, rough idle, difficulty starting when cold, or a noticeable loss in throttle response. A scheduled inspection during routine service lets you confirm gap condition and electrode wear before performance degrades.
- Check plugs during major services or if the engine shows roughness.
- Inspect for carbon buildup, oil deposits, or erosion of the center electrode.
- Replace sooner if you routinely tow, haul heavy loads, or do lots of short trips.
How Heat Range Affects Tow and Load Performance
Towing and heavy loads increase combustion chamber temperatures and can push a plug into a hotter effective range. Picking an appropriate heat range helps prevent pre-ignition and maintains stable combustion under sustained load.
If you regularly use the Titan for towing or heavy payloads, prefer plugs with a thermal rating that resists overheating while still clearing deposits during short trips. Manufacturer heat charts and the vehicle's service manual can guide the correct selection.
- Heavy-duty use benefits from cooler-rated plugs to avoid heat soak.
- Frequent short trips may need a hotter-rated plug to ward off fouling.
Preparing for Installation: Tools and Best Practices
Correct tools and technique reduce the risk of damaging the spark plug or cylinder head. Use a torque wrench, the right socket with a protective insert, and a reliable gap gauge. Clean the plug wells and apply anti-seize only if recommended by the plug manufacturer and the vehicle manual.
Install plugs one at a time to avoid mixing up gaps or thread engagement, and always torque to specification. If your Titan uses ignition coils over the plugs, inspect coil boots and electrical connectors while the plugs are accessible to avoid future ignition faults.
- Bring the engine to room temperature before removing plugs to reduce risk of thread damage.
- Replace boots or seals if brittle or damaged to ensure a solid electrical connection.
- Re-check gap only with a non-marring gauge designed for fine-wire iridium tips.
Common Spark Plug Symptoms and Troubleshooting
Certain symptoms point to spark plug issues rather than other ignition components. Misfires, especially under load or at idle, visible deposit patterns on removed plugs, and a persistent rough start can all indicate plugs are at fault.
When diagnosing, isolate plug-related problems by checking ignition coils, fuel delivery, and compression in sequence. Examining plug condition provides clues about air-fuel mixture, oil consumption, or ignition timing that help pinpoint the root cause.
- Black sooty deposits often indicate a rich mixture or weak ignition.
- Oily deposits suggest valve guide seal or piston ring wear allowing oil into the combustion chamber.
- Eroded center electrodes typically correlate with high mileage and signal replacement.
Gap Settings and Why Exact Measurements Matter
The spark plug gap must match the ignition system's capability and the engine's compression characteristics. Too wide a gap can cause misfires under load, while too narrow a gap reduces spark energy and efficiency. Follow the gap specification for the Titan and verify before installation.
Iridium plugs are sensitive to improper gapping because their fine center electrodes can be damaged by rough handling. Use a precision feeler or wire-style gapping tool designed for fine-wire tips, and avoid bending the center electrode when adjusting.
- Confirm the specified gap in the vehicle manual before installing replacement plugs.
- Adjust gaps carefully and re-torque after installation to maintain contact integrity.

FAQ
How often should I replace Iridium spark plugs in my Nissan Titan?
Iridium plugs typically last much longer than copper plugs, often well beyond standard intervals, but replacement depends on driving habits. Check plugs at recommended service intervals and consider earlier replacement if you notice misfires, rough idle, or increased fuel consumption.
Can I gap Iridium spark plugs myself and how precise should I be?
Yes, you can gap iridium plugs, but use a non-marring gauge and be careful not to damage the fine center electrode. Aim for the vehicle-specified gap and adjust gently to avoid bending the tip.
What does a fouled spark plug look like and what causes it?
Fouled plugs often show heavy black sooty deposits for rich mixtures or oily coatings if oil is entering the combustion chamber. Causes include running rich, worn valve guides or piston rings, or short-trip driving that does not allow plugs to reach self-cleaning temperatures.
Will a different heat range prevent all misfires when towing?
A correct heat range can reduce misfires related to overheating or fouling, but not all towing-related misfires. Ignition coils, fuel delivery, and engine tuning also affect performance, so consider heat range as one element in a broader diagnosis.
Should I replace ignition boots or coils when changing spark plugs?
Inspect boots and coils whenever plugs are accessible; replace brittle boots or coils with weak output. Fresh plugs with worn ignition components can still produce misfires, so it is practical to address any visibly degraded ignition parts during plug service.
Does using iridium plugs change recommended maintenance intervals?
Iridium plugs often extend the interval between changes due to their wear resistance, but you should still follow inspection schedules and replace plugs based on condition and symptoms rather than relying solely on mileage.
